What is CODE function in Excel?

CODE function is one of TEXT functions in Microsoft Excel that returns a numeric code for the first character in a text string. The returned code corresponds to the character set used by your computer.

Operating environment Character set
Macintosh Macintosh character set
Windows ANSI

Syntax of CODE function

CODE(text)

The CODE function syntax has the following arguments:

  • Text    Required. The text for which you want the code of the first character.

Formula Description Result
=CODE(“A”) Displays the numeric code for A 65
=CODE(“!”) Displays the numeric code for ! 33
